How to configure QT6 static?
-
This is my configure:
md build\static-debug ..\..\configure.bat ^ -platform win32-msvc ^ -nomake tests ^ -nomake examples ^ -opensource -confirm-license ^ -prefix ..\..\output\static-debug ^ -no-pch ^ -debug ^ -static ^ -static-runtime ^ -ssl ^ -openssl ^ -openssl-linked ^ -icu ^ -gif ^ -ico ^ -opengl ^ -no-egl ^ -no-vulkan ^ -no-xcb ^ -no-libudev ^ -no-slog2 ^ -no-dbus ^ -skip qtdoc ^ -skip qtwayland ^ -skip qtwebengine ^ -skip qtwebview ^ -system-zlib ^ -system-libpng ^ -system-libjpeg ^ -system-freetype ^ -system-harfbuzz ^ -system-sqlite ^ -system-pcre ^ -system-doubleconversion ^ -system-webp ^ -system-tiff
however, build failed with:
正在创建库 qtshadertools\tools\qsb\qsb.lib 和对象 qtshadertools\tools\qsb\qsb.exp tiffd.lib(tif_lzma.c.obj) : error LNK2019: 无法解析的外部符号 lzma_code,函数 LZMAEncode 中引用了该符号 tiffd.lib(tif_lzma.c.obj) : error LNK2019: 无法解析的外部符号 lzma_end,函数 LZMASetupDecode 中引用了该符号 tiffd.lib(tif_lzma.c.obj) : error LNK2019: 无法解析的外部符号 lzma_memusage,函数 LZMADecode 中引用了该符号 tiffd.lib(tif_lzma.c.obj) : error LNK2019: 无法解析的外部符号 lzma_lzma_preset,函数 TIFFInitLZMA 中引用了该符号 tiffd.lib(tif_lzma.c.obj) : error LNK2019: 无法解析的外部符号 lzma_stream_encoder,函数 LZMAPreEncode 中引用了该符号 tiffd.lib(tif_lzma.c.obj) : error LNK2019: 无法解析的外部符号 lzma_stream_decoder,函数 LZMADecode 中引用了该符号 libwebp.lib(picture_csp_enc.c.obj) : error LNK2019: 无法解析的外部符号 SharpYuvConvert,函数 PreprocessARGB 中引用了该符号 libwebp.lib(picture_csp_enc.c.obj) : error LNK2019: 无法解析的外部符号 SharpYuvGetConversionMatrix,函数 PreprocessARGB 中引用了该符号 libwebp.lib(picture_csp_enc.c.obj) : error LNK2019: 无法解析的外部符号 SharpYuvInit,函数 ImportYUVAFromRGBA 中引用了该符号 harfbuzz.lib(hb-uniscribe.cc.obj) : error LNK2019: 无法解析的外部符号 __imp_UuidCreate,函数 "void __cdecl _hb_generate_unique_face_name(wchar_t *,unsigned int *)" (?_hb_generate_unique_face_name@@YAXPEA_WPEAI@Z) 中引用了该符号 harfbuzz.lib(hb-uniscribe.cc.obj) : error LNK2019: 无法解析的外部符号 ScriptFreeCache,函数 _hb_uniscribe_shaper_font_data_destroy 中引用了该符号 harfbuzz.lib(hb-uniscribe.cc.obj) : error LNK2019: 无法解析的外部符号 ScriptItemize,函数 "long __cdecl hb_ScriptItemizeOpenType(wchar_t const *,int,int,struct tag_SCRIPT_CONTROL const *,struct tag_SCRIPT_STATE const *,struct tag_SCRIPT_ITEM *,unsigned long *,int *)" (?hb_ScriptItemizeOpenType@@YAJPEB_WHHPEBUtag_SCRIPT_CONTROL@@PEBUtag_SCRIPT_STATE@@PEAUtag_SCRIPT_ITEM@@PEAKPEAH@Z) 中引用了该符号 harfbuzz.lib(hb-uniscribe.cc.obj) : error LNK2019: 无法解析的外部符号 ScriptShape,函数 "long __cdecl hb_ScriptShapeOpenType(struct HDC__ *,void * *,struct tag_SCRIPT_ANALYSIS *,unsigned long,unsigned long,int *,struct textrange_properties * *,int,wchar_t const *,int,int,unsigned short *,struct script_charprop *,unsigned short *,struct script_glyphprop *,int *)" (?hb_ScriptShapeOpenType@@YAJPEAUHDC__@@PEAPEAXPEAUtag_SCRIPT_ANALYSIS@@KKPEAHPEAPEAUtextrange_properties@@HPEB_WHHPEAGPEAUscript_charprop@@6PEAUscript_glyphprop@@3@Z) 中引用了该符号 harfbuzz.lib(hb-uniscribe.cc.obj) : error LNK2019: 无法解析的外部符号 ScriptPlace,函数 "long __cdecl hb_ScriptPlaceOpenType(struct HDC__ *,void * *,struct tag_SCRIPT_ANALYSIS *,unsigned long,unsigned long,int *,struct textrange_properties * *,int,wchar_t const *,unsigned short *,struct script_charprop *,int,unsigned short const *,struct script_glyphprop const *,int,int *,struct tagGOFFSET *,struct _ABC *)" (?hb_ScriptPlaceOpenType@@YAJPEAUHDC__@@PEAPEAXPEAUtag_SCRIPT_ANALYSIS@@KKPEAHPEAPEAUtextrange_properties@@HPEB_WPEAGPEAUscript_charprop@@HPEBGPEBUscript_glyphprop@@H3PEAUtagGOFFSET@@PEAU_ABC@@@Z) 中引用了该符号 freetyped.lib(sfnt.c.obj) : error LNK2019: 无法解析的外部符号 BrotliDecoderDecompress,函数 woff2_decompress 中引用了该符号 freetyped.lib(ftbzip2.c.obj) : error LNK2019: 无法解析的外部符号 BZ2_bzDecompressInit,函数 ft_bzip2_file_init 中引用了该符号 freetyped.lib(ftbzip2.c.obj) : error LNK2019: 无法解析的外部符号 BZ2_bzDecompress,函数 ft_bzip2_file_fill_output 中引用了该符号 freetyped.lib(ftbzip2.c.obj) : error LNK2019: 无法解析的外部符号 BZ2_bzDecompressEnd,函数 ft_bzip2_file_done 中引用了该符号 qtbase\bin\qsb.exe : fatal error LNK1120: 18 个无法解析的外部命令
how to add liblzma.lib and other libraries to cmake?
-
I use cmake directly and successful. This is my configure:
cmake -S ../.. ^ -G Ninja ^ -DCMAKE_BUILD_TYPE=Debug ^ -DBUILD_SHARED_LIBS=OFF ^ -DFEATURE_static_runtime=ON ^ -DCMAKE_INSTALL_PREFIX="C:/Library/QT/6.8.1/VS2019/x64-debug-static" ^ -DBUILD_qtdoc=OFF ^ -DBUILD_qtwebengine=OFF ^ -DBUILD_qtwebview=OFF ^ -DBUILD_qtwayland=OFF ^ -DBUILD_WITH_PCH=OFF ^ -DQT_INTERNAL_CALLED_FROM_CONFIGURE:BOOL=TRUE ^ -DQT_QMAKE_TARGET_MKSPEC=win32-msvc ^ -DCMAKE_C_COMPILER=cl ^ -DCMAKE_CXX_COMPILER=cl ^ -DQT_BUILD_TESTS=FALSE ^ -DQT_BUILD_EXAMPLES=FALSE ^ -DFEATURE_cxx20=OFF ^ -DFEATURE_cxx2b=OFF ^ -DFEATURE_ssl=ON ^ -DINPUT_openssl=linked ^ -DFEATURE_system_zlib=ON ^ -DFEATURE_system_sqlite=ON ^ -DINPUT_libpng=system ^ -DINPUT_libjpeg=system ^ -DINPUT_freetype=system ^ -DINPUT_harfbuzz=system ^ -DINPUT_pcre=system ^ -DINPUT_doubleconversion=system ^ -DINPUT_webp=system ^ -DINPUT_tiff=system ^ -DFEATURE_icu=ON ^ -DFEATURE_gif=ON ^ -DFEATURE_ico=ON ^ -DFEATURE_vulkan=OFF ^ -DFEATURE_xcb=OFF ^ -DFEATURE_egl=OFF ^ -DFEATURE_libudev=OFF ^ -DFEATURE_slog2=OFF ^ -DFEATURE_dbus=OFF ^ -DCMAKE_CXX_STANDARD=17 ^ -DCMAKE_C_STANDARD=11 ^ -DCMAKE_EXE_LINKER_FLAGS="brotlicommon.lib brotlidec.lib brotlienc.lib bz2d.lib deflatestatic.lib libsharpyuv.lib lzma.lib rpcrt4.lib usp10.lib"
The key should be to specify libs using CMAKE_EXE_LINKER_FLAGS
